* QTreeView: Fix QTreeViewPrivate::itemAtCoordinate()Christian Ehrlicher2018-01-021-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| QTreeViewPrivate::itemAtCoordinate() did not calculate the correct item when non-uniformRowHeights is enabled and vertical scroll mode is ScrollPerPixel. This results e.g. in an activation of the item above when the click happens on the very first pixel line of an item. Another, more problematic effect was that once a drop happened on the very first line of an item, QAbstractItemViewPrivate::dropOn() calculated the root as the drop index because the visualRect of the calculated item is compared with the drop position which did not match. * Disable WiFi bearer plugins on macOS and WindowsMorten Johan Sørvig2017-12-151-5/+0
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Scanning for WiFi networks is causing network disruptions in the form of higher latency, sometimes globally for all running applications. In practice, the default configuration selection algorithm in QNetworkConfigurationManager prefers configurations from the generic bearer plugin, due to the way the plugins are ordered. Removing the platform WiFi bearers should have no effect on default network configuration selection. * Fix an issue causing asset catalogs to be miscompiled with iOS simulatorJake Petroules2017-12-141-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This works around the inability to build iOS apps for a "generic" simulator by explicitly setting the Xcode build setting ENABLE_ONLY_ACTIVE_RESOURCES to NO in order to ensure that all variants of assets in an asset catalog are built when targeting iOS simulator devices. Otherwise, we will simply build for whatever the first simulator in the list happens to be. If the application is then deployed to a different simulator, some of the assets needed for that device variant may be missing. This "helps" QTCREATORBUG-19447 but is not a workaround since this fix is necessary for command line builds anyways, even though it's unlikely to crop up in practice there, since one would have to manually deploy the built application bundle to the simulator using simctl rather than going through Xcode (which would rebuild for the appropriate device). * QFileSystemModel: Enable experimental code path for per-file watchingFriedemann Kleint2017-12-142-18/+20
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| QFileSystemModel had a #ifdefed out experimental code path for watching single files to track changes in size, which got outdated over time. Replace the #ifdef 0 by a check for the environment variable QT_FILESYSTEMMODEL_WATCH_FILES, fix it up and apply some fixes to related code to make it work: - Split file names signaled by QFileSystemWatcher on '/' always. - Do not instantiate QDirIterator on "", which means "current directory" and results in mixed-up directories. - Check on lastModified() in QExtendedInformation::operator==() so that changes trigger an update in _q_fileSystemChanged(). - Fix the #ifdefed out part to compile and not to add directories to the watcher. [ChangeLog][QtWidgets][QFileSystemModel] It is now possible to enable per-file watching by setting the environment variable QT_FILESYSTEMMODEL_WATCH_FILES, allowing to track for example changes in file size.
